3.6.2 Terminal Device Data

Terminal Type
Applicability All HVAC zones
Definition

A terminal unit includes any device serving a zone (or group of zones collected in a thermal block) that has the ability to reheat or recool in response to the zone thermostat. This includes:

  • None (the case for single zone units)
  • VAV box
  • Series Fan-Powered VAV  box
  • Parallel Fan-Powered VAV box
  • Induction-type VAV box
  • Dual-duct mixing box (constant volume and VAV)
  • Two and three duct mixing dampers (multi-zone systems)
  • Reheat coil (constant volume systems)
  • Perimeter induction units
Units List (see above)
Input Restrictions As designed

90.1-2019

Terminal Type

Applicability

All HVAC zones

Definition

A terminal unit includes any device serving a zone (or group of zones collected in a thermal zone) that has the ability to reheat or re-cool in response to the zone thermostat. This includes:

  • None (the case for single zone units)
  • VAV box
  • Series fan-powered VAV box
  • Parallel fan-powered VAV box
  • Induction-type VAV box
  • Dual-duct mixing box (constant volume and VAV)
  • Two- and three-duct mixing dampers (multi-zone systems)
  • Reheat coil (constant volume systems)
  • Perimeter induction units
  • Chilled beams
  • Radiant heating and cooling
  • Fan coil units
  • Variable refrigerant flow terminal units

Units

List (see above)

Input Restrictions

As designed

Baseline Building

Table 37 specifies the HVAC terminal device for each of the baseline building systems. See Table 3 for a summary of the HVAC mapping.

Table 37. Baseline Building HVAC Terminal Devices

Baseline System HVAC Terminal Type

 

Baseline Building System

Terminal Type

System 1

PTAC

None

System 2

PTHP

None

System 3

PSZ AC

None

System 4

PSZ HP

None

System 5

PVAV reheat

VAV with hot water reheat

System 6

Packaged VAV with PFP boxes

Parallel fan-powered boxes with electric reheat

System 7

VAV with Reheat

VAV with hot water reheat

System 8

VAV with PFP boxes

Parallel fan-powered boxes with electric reheat

System 9

Heating and ventilation

None

System 10

Heating and ventilation

None

System 11

SZ-VAV

None

System 12

SZ-CV-HW

None

System 13

SZ-CV-ER

None
